Output d39345836cf4e61ea8ce9daef0f032e10001ce275dc03aa6e1d28d4626b07cf9:2

value
279150161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42002558f4df21c48706fd4f000465472802bfde OP_EQUAL
address
37hzhLjeYgJL4inDP5bb9pLKT9nPUQVXeQ
transaction
d39345836cf4e61ea8ce9daef0f032e10001ce275dc03aa6e1d28d4626b07cf9
confirmations
333485
spent
true